Cherry Chocolate Chip Pie

Description

A delightful Cherry Chocolate Chip Pie featuring a flaky crust, tart cherries, and melty chocolate – perfect for dessert lovers.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for dusting
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up cold unsalted butter, cut into small cubes
  • 1/4 cup cold vegetable shortening, cut into small pieces
  • 5 to 7 tablespoons ice water
  • 4 cups fresh or frozen pitted cherries, thawed and drained if frozen
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up cornstarch
  • 1/4 teaspoon almond extract
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1 large egg, beaten
  • 1 tablespoon milk or water
  • Turbinado sugar or granulated sugar for sprinkling

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our and salt.
  2. Add the cold butter and shortening to the flour mixture. Use a pastry blender or your fingertips to cut the fat into the flour until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  3. Gradually add the ice water one tablespoon at a time, mixing gently after each addition until the dough just comes together.
  4.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face, gather into a ball, then divide in half and flatten each half into a disc. Wrap tightly in plastic and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
  5. Roll out one disc of dough into a 12-inch circle and transfer it to a 9-inch pie plate. Trim edges, leaving a 1-inch overhang.
  6. Crimp edges of the crust using fingers or fork.
  7. Chill the crust in the refrigerator.
  8. In a large bowl, combine cherries, sugar, cornstarch, almond extract, lemon juice, and salt. Gently toss to coat.
  9. Fold in the chocolate chips.
  10. Pour the filling into the chilled pie crust.
  11. Roll out the remaining disc of dough into a 12-inch circle. Place it over the filling, trim edges, and crimp to seal.
  12. Cut several slits in the top crust to allow steam to escape.
  13. Brush the top crust with an egg wash made from egg and milk or water, and sprinkle with sugar.
  14.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Bake for 15 minutes, then reduce temperature to 375°F (190°C) and bake for an additional 35 to 45 minutes until golden brown.
  15. Let the pie cool completely on a wire rack before slicing and serving.

Notes

Ensure to chill the dough to maintain flakiness. You may substitute ingredients as per your preference.
